Gross capital formation in Bahamas
Bahamas: Gross capital formation was 26.8% in 2024. ▲ Rising
Gross capital formation in Bahamas, 1977–2024
Source: Country official statistics, National Statistical Organizations and/or Central Banks. Measured in % of GDP.
Analysis
Bahamas recorded 26.8% for gross capital formation in 2024.
The figure is up 17.2% on the previous year and down 14.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, gross capital formation in Bahamas peaked at 33.5% in 2006 and was at its lowest, 11.3%, in 1978.
That places Bahamas 58th out of 187 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 47 years of available data.

About this data
Gross capital formation includes acquisitions less disposals of produced assets for purposes of fixed capital formation, inventories or valuables. This indicator is expressed as a percentage of Gross Domestic Product (GDP) which is the total income earned through the production of goods and services in an economic territory during an accounting period.
